IAED Emergency Telecommunicator Certification

Course Description: The Emergency Telecommunicator course provides an introduction to emergency telecommunication centers’ technology, processes, and ethics. The course is designed to prepare you to learn effective communication in an emergency situation and help you earn a certification through the International Academies of Emergency Dispatch (IAED) as Emergency Telecommunicators. Training includes instruction in, but not limited to, the following: emergency telecommunication technology, interpersonal communication, caller management, classification of police, fire, and medical calls, legal aspects of public safety communication and, stress factors and management in the emergency telecommunication field. 

This course is approved by NJ OETS for Basic Telecommunicator Certification.

NJ Emergency Medical Dispatch Course

Course Description: This course is the state mandated 32 Hour Emergency Medical Dispatch Program. This course is designed to provide dispatchers (Police/Fire/EMS) with the necessary information and skills to function as an EMD. This course will provide students with the secondary level of certification that is required for any officer or dispatcher who will answer 9-1-1 Medical Calls. Topics include: responsibilities of an EMD, legal/liability issues, providing proper medical instructions by phone, and use of the emergency medical dispatch guide cards. This course includes role-playing simulated 9-1-1 medical calls.

Prerequisites:
1.     A valid Healthcare Provider (or equivalent) CPR card
2.     Current certification as a 911 Basic Telecommunicator Certification or proof of course completion.

Education Credit: Elective CEUs for EMTs/Paramedics pending OEMS Approval

NJ EMD Refresher

Course Description: The State of New Jersey EMD program requires a minimum of 24 hours of continuing education every three years following initial certification.  Some dispatchers have fallen behind on their CTE, and as such, when their EMD is coming up on expiration, they haven’t completed the necessary training.  This course provides you with 8 CTE units towards your recertification as an Emergency Medical Dispatcher certification with the Office of Emergency Telecommunications Services.

Prerequisites:
1.      A valid Healthcare Provider (or equivalent) CPR card
2.      Current certification as an NJ Emergency Medical Dispatcher

Education Credit: 8 CTEs for NJ Emergency Medical Dispatchers
